Output 904a731fb9c812284bb61a4c5b46ace3aa9f11c8f01dcf390d64be49cdf2bc97:2

value
70524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0224a43afd95ffb13b1a2554128de69bb026ce78 OP_EQUAL
address
31tMAppGbYLtsnmgMJctqyMtQbRxvQV7Kg
transaction
904a731fb9c812284bb61a4c5b46ace3aa9f11c8f01dcf390d64be49cdf2bc97
confirmations
11317
spent
true